Mount Vernon: XS

Personally, I’m not a huge fan of diners. With so many different options on the menu everything usually ends up tasting kind of ‘meh.’ So when I heard about XS and looked at their menu, I wasn’t expecting too much because they offered a little bit of everything. However I read some pretty great reviews on Yelp so I decided to get over myself and head to Mount Vernon to try XS anyway, and boy am I glad that I did. The menu at XS covers everything from brunch to sushi to cocktails and more. On this particular visit I tried some of their brunch options, but I will be back soon to sample more of the items on their menu.

Fun fact, this restaurant is not for you if you cannot climb up multiple flights of stairs. But the atmosphere inside is incredible. There’s tons of art and it’s just an overall interesting place that’s worth a visit for the scenery alone. Because it was only 10am, even though XS has plenty of options no matter what you’re craving, my friend and I decided to stick with ordering traditional brunch options.

My friend ordered the Cinnamon French Toast with Cream Cheese Icing. She was afraid the icing would be too sweet for her and she ordered it on the side. The dish comes with two thick pieces of french toast sprinkled with powdered sugar and some cream cheese icing. The dish was too decadent for me but my friend loved it. She said it tasted like a cinnamon bun and she would order it again in an instant.

Personally, I have a thing for Mexican-inspired egg dishes so I ordered the Breakfast Burrito. It was a tortilla stuffed with scrambled eggs, onions, peppers, pepper jack cheese and bacon. This was one of the better breakfast burritos I’ve tried because the egg/tortilla proportion was on point and the dish wasn’t overpowered by a bready flavor.

My friend and I also decided to split an order of the Sweet Potato Tater Tots. They were good, and tasted great dipped in the ranch, but inside the fried exterior, it was a little bit mushy instead of the shredded tot texture that I was used to.

Even though I was skeptical to try XS because of their wide range of options, I’m glad I made the decision to try it because we absolutely loved everything. I went back at a later date and enjoyed some of their sushi and dinner options, read my review of dinner at XS.

XS is located at 1307 N Charles St., in Mount Vernon.
